Dr. Charles Moore
Curator and Art Critic
Dr. Charles Moore is a curator and art critic. He earned a master’s in museum studies from Harvard University and a doctorate at Columbia University. His writings have appeared in publications such as Artnet, ARTnews, The Art Newspaper, Brooklyn Rail, CULTURED, Frieze Magazine, and Juxtapoz. He is the author of The Black Market: A Guide to Art Collecting (2020), 24-Hour Interview (2025), Global Conversations: Mexico (2025), and On Painting (2026). His curatorial practice is driven by sustained dialogue with artists, using exhibitions as intellectual and emotional frameworks through which abstraction, history, and lived experience are brought together.
